Output 6fb39d4a021eb4bbf3c3a6fbc0cd979860b58a811698a0fb2e057a2b9582a976:1

value
2333334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dad052b49d537760475b2bd08628de089d2967a OP_EQUAL
address
3Ec8UFCBrGZnDqVYmNygJbksff3YAbo1zA
transaction
6fb39d4a021eb4bbf3c3a6fbc0cd979860b58a811698a0fb2e057a2b9582a976
spent
true